Purview
noun
The scope or limit of someone's role, duty or work.
Environmental protection is within the purview of the agency.

Often appears as...
- falls within the purview
- outside the purview
Usage tips
Formal
Academic
noun
The range of influence or control.
Such matters do not come under the purview of this department.

Often appears as...
- under the purview
- within the purview
Usage tips
Formal
Technical
noun
The range of vision, understanding or knowledge.
Usage of these funds falls outside the purview of the law.

Often appears as...
- falls outside the purview
- within legal purview
Usage tips
Formal, Disapproving
Legal

Definition 1 of 3

Not Physical
Purview isn't about physical space, but roles or responsibilities.

The new policies are within the purview of HR, not IT.
Implies Authority
Using 'purview' suggests authority or ownership over a task or area.

Curriculum development is within the purview of the academic committee.
Boundaries of Role
'Purview' helps clarify the limits of a person's role or duty.

Decisions about budget cuts are outside my purview as a teacher.
